Hot Fuzz (2007)

I just started a "Why is Simon Pegg" so great thread on the message board cause I just do not understand why people are bowing to him and Edgar Wright over this film and Shaun of the Dead.
I went into this film after reading more then a dozen reviews talking about how great it was. I went into this film knowing that it was on IMDB's top 250 greatest movies of all time list with over 80,000 votes and an 8.1 rating. I also went into this film knowing that I did NOT like Shaun of the Dead and that I probably wouldn't like this one ..... and I was right.
British humor is very different from American humor. I have always realized that and I understand that my personal preference is not British humor. I guess it started with Mr. Bean... which I use to love watching as a kid on HBO but for film it never really took off for me.
When the film first started I was getting into it. I liked the fact that Pegg was this hard ass, by the book cop that was getting thrown into a town where no one really had respect for the law. With a surprise appearance of the former James Bond Timothy Dalton I was even more intrigued. Up until the point where they find the weapons and sea mine, which was a pretty funny part.....I was into it but after that the film drastically started getting boring.
No matter what I say I am going to have 15 people tell me that "you don't understand the film" or blah blah blah....any excuse in the world to tell me that I am wrong....just as Gina suffered with her not-so-good review of this film.
I really don't care though, I didn't like it and actually I feel like I am being too generous giving this film the star rating that I did.....I really wanted to give it one star just because I had to literally MAKE myself finish it.
